Orlando Pirates FC Signs Angolan Striker Delvi Miguel Vieira “Gibelé”

South African side Orlando Pirates Football Club officially announced on Friday morning, June 28, the signing of Delvi Miguel Vieira “Gibelé”. The 23-year-old player joins the Club on a three-year contract after undergoing a medical and finalizing personal terms.

On the Club’s official website, it is highlighted that Delvi, better known as Gilberto, joins the Buccaneers after two seasons with Angolan champion Girabola Petro de Luanda.

The Management of Orlando Pirates Football Club also highlights that the Angolan striker is coming off an impressive season in which he debuted in the African Cup of Nations in Côte d’Ivoire at the beginning of the year, helping to guide Angola to the quarter-finals of the competition .

According to the note that the RNA Online Editor had access to, Gilberto is expected to return to Angola today where he will finalize the necessary paperwork so that he can join the squad for their pre-season tour to Spain starting on July 8 .
